There was a lot that went into MT's struggles

 

1) I firmly believe the lack of playing time in the pre season hurt him. As well as Rodgers to an extent it appeared.

 

2) Absolutely criminal misuse of Montgomery. As well as not utilizing Miller in the passing game.

 

3) Nagy tried to be too cute at times. Almost like Chip Kelly, refusing to get out of their own way.

 

4) Green Bay also deserved a lot of credit. Their GM did a fantastic job revamping their D. You have to tip your cap to Pettine and the job hes done with getting a lot of newer additions all on the same page.

I would be disappointed.  But a bad outing by Allen in week 1 wouldn't exactly shock me.  With a whole new cast on the offense and having only played about 4 quarters in pre-season I would expect the Bills O to get off to a slow start.  Honestly what would shock me the most is if the Bills offense & Allen start off hot in the 1st quarter.

 

And lets not forget what others have noted: the NFL season is a marathon not a sprint.  Remember how after we traded for Drew Bledsoe we opened the season by crushing New England 31 - 0!  And Bledsoe was SHARP.  Then the next week we go on the road and beat Jacksonville 35 - 17!  Talk about visions of Super Bowls dancing in our heads.  But how did that season end?  As I recall we finished 8 - 8 and missed the playoffs.
